Ryuichi Nitta

Ryuichi Nitta is a Japanese composer renowned for his contributions to video game music, particularly in the late 1980s and early 1990s. He is best known for his work on "Ninja Gaiden 2: The Dark Sword of Chaos" (1989), where his compositions helped define the game's intense atmosphere and enhance the player's experience. Nitta's distinctive blend of melodic and rhythmic elements has left a lasting impact on the action-platformer genre. Beyond "Ninja Gaiden 2," he has worked on various titles across different platforms, showcasing his versatility and talent. His innovative use of sound and music continues to inspire contemporary game composers, making him a key figure in the evolution of video game soundtracks.
